This document discusses how to track conversions from Facebook ads using both Facebook Pixel tracking and Google Analytics. It recommends adding Facebook Pixel and Google Analytics tracking code to advertised webpages. Key actions like clicks, events, and ecommerce transactions can then be triggered and sent to both Facebook and Google Analytics for reporting. This allows advertisers to double check conversion metrics from Facebook ads across both platforms for accuracy.

This document discusses how to build a culture of measurement within an organization. It provides examples of companies like Cabela's and Barclaycard that have successfully cultivated measurement cultures. The key benefits are using data to increase revenue, lower costs, and improve customer satisfaction. However, changing an organization's culture presents challenges. The document recommends understanding current cultural roots, deploying measurement strategies in a phased approach, and communicating the value of measurement through stories.
